prowl car (plural prowl cars)
- (US, dated, slang) A police patrol car.
- 1939, Raymond Chandler, The Big Sleep, Penguin 2011, p. 106:
- I said: ‘Let the prowl car pass up the hill. They'll think we moved over when we heard the siren.’
